About the job

This job is about providing essential administrative support to the Melbourne office of FTI Consulting. As the first point of contact for guests, clients, and visitors, you will play a crucial role in creating a welcoming environment. The team values collaboration and diversity, fostering an atmosphere where everyone can grow and make a real impact.

You'll be responsible for

πŸ“ž

Answering phone calls

Responding to phone calls in a professional and efficient manner, ensuring messages are distributed to the appropriate staff members.
πŸ“…

Managing meeting room bookings

Ensuring all logistical requirements for meeting rooms are prepared and bookings are entered into the system.
πŸ‘‹

Greeting guests

Meeting and greeting guests to present a professional company image at all times.
